Standard Catalog of United States Tokens 1700-1900 (4th ed.) by Russell Rulau. Published 2004 by Krause Publications.
This book is the most extensive resource available for identifying U.S. tokens. Descriptions and values in up to 4 grades are provided by one of the world's top token and medal authorities for Early American, Hard Times, merchant, trade, Civil War and Gay Nineties pieces. The 4th edition includes hundreds of new listings and thoroughly update pricing reflecting recent dramatic increases in the market value of these popular collectibles. 1200 pages with more than 5000 photos. Standard Catalog of Hard Times Tokens 1832-1844 (9th ed.) by Russell Rulau. Published 2001 by Krause Publications.
Considered the preeminent cataloger of American tokens, author Russell Rulau has assembled the most complete reference ever of the coin substitutes, merchant counterstamps and satirical scrip from the era of Presidents Jackson and Van Buren. 224 pages, 1000 photos. This well researched book begins with historical background information on the political and monetary circumstances which led to the proliferation of tokens and other alternatives to coins during the Civil War era. It continues with information on grading and pricing, fakes and replicas, and a catalog of political tokens, medalets, store cards, etc. The second part of the book contains "die-a-grams" or photographic charts to aid the collector in differentiating among similar dies. 435 pages.
Medallic Portraits of Washington (2nd ed.) by Russell Rulau and George Fuld. Published 1999 by Krause Publications.
George Washington remains a favorite subject of numismatists worldwide. In this comprehensive volume, researched by two of the most highly respected authorities on medals and tokens, you will find detailed descriptions, clear photographs and values for up to three grades for Washington coins, medals, tokens, plaques and badges issued around the world from 1783 to the publication date. 318 pages. Latin American Tokens (2nd ed.) by Russell Rulau. Published 2000 by Krause Publications.
Thousand of tokens - mostly workplace tallies - were issued throughout Latin American during the era of haciendas, mines, mills and docks. This English language volume covers tokens issed from 1700-1920 in Mexico, Central America and South America and from 1700-1960 in the West Indies.
